6. RunDisney races If you’re a runDisney fan, then winter is an excellent time to visit. The Walt Disney World Marathon and the Disney Princess Half Marathon weekends both take place during the winter—one in January and one in February. 4. Disney’s BoardWalk Disney’s BoardWalk is a quarter-mile stretch filled with shops, restaurants, and nightlife. This turn-of-the-century themed boardwalk is a real treat, especially for those staying at Disney’s BoardWalk Inn.
